West Arlington, Baltimore, MD Local Guide

How much does it cost to rent an apartment in West Arlington?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
West Arlington Studio Apartments | $1,132 | $1,085 | $1,210 |
West Arlington 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,279 | $600 | $2,361 |
West Arlington 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,529 | $805 | $2,819 |
West Arlington 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,731 | $895 | $2,375 |
West Arlington 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,091 | $700 | $3,000 |

Getting Around the West Arlington Neighborhood in Baltimore, MD
Walk Score®
53 / 100
Somewhat Walkable
Some errands can be accomplished on foot
Bike Score®
47 / 100
Somewhat Bikeable
Minimal bike infrastructure
Transit Score®
74 / 100
Excellent Transit
Transit is convenient for most trips
What Are Walk Score®, Transit Score®, and Bike Score® Ratings?
- Walk Score® measures the walkability of any address.
- Transit Score® measures access to public transit.
- Bike Score® measures the bikeability of any address.
